Manufacturing and mechanical characterization of square bar made of aluminium scraps through friction stir back extrusion process

Abstract: Purpose The purpose of this paper is to manufacture an aluminium square cross-sectional bar by using conventional lathe machine from aluminium scraps through friction stir back extrusion (FSBE) process and study the viability of the process to produce the square bar. “…Studies have shown that this method can produce sound and hole-free rods and tubes in which the microstructure of the raw material is modified through a dynamic recrystallisation mechanism. The significance of this method as a solid-state process lies in characteristics such as creating a fine equiaxed microstructure, controlling the chemical composition during the process, using simple equipment, and performing the process in one step [13]. The main parameters in this process are rotational speed, extrusion speed, axial force, and punch diameter.…”
